The post-July 4 weekend found three women—Lousy-Hand Lois, Ardent Arlene and Coy Carolyn, playing animated games of Uno. They decided to call themselves the Truno Tribe—”Tr” for trio, “uno” for Uno. Below is the poem they penned as they played:
All is fair in love and Uno,
Especially with the players Truno.
Are we true? Definitely no!
We cheat and bleat and cheat so.
Red, blue, now yellow, now green.
All who listen hear us scream.
Skip. Reverse—Change to the left.
What? You lost. Are you bereft?
Wild women we are—wild cards we give.
Making us anxious to raid the fridge.
We groaned and gasped and sighed,
Before we finally said goodby.
Ok, so much for great poetry! But we had so much fun, with lots of laughter and frustration, that the one of us thwarted a migraine headache that was trying to disable her!
